리눅스 커널 6.13: 새로운 기능과 개선 사항 총정리
리눅스 커널 6.13 출시: 주요 변화들
안녕하세요, 리눅스 애호가 여러분! 오늘은 리눅스 커널의 새로운 버전, 리눅스 커널 6.13에 대한 소식을 전해드리려고 합니다. 이번 릴리스에서는 업데이트된 Raspberry Pi 그래픽 드라이버, 지연 프리엠프션(logic), Rust 지원 확장, 그리고 다양한 하드웨어 드라이버가 포함되어 있습니다. 흥미진진하게도, 인텔과 AMD의 새로운 CPU 및 GPU에 대한 지원도 지속적으로 이루어지고 있습니다.
리눅스 창시자인 리누스 토발즈는 최근 리눅스 커널 메일링 리스트를 통해 6.13 버전의 출시를 조용히 확인했습니다. 그는 "지난 주에 특별한 문제가 없어서 최종 6.13 버전을 태그하고 발행했다"라고 밝혔습니다.
리눅스 6.13의 주요 특징 및 변경 사항
리눅스 커널 6.13에서는 지연(preemption) 지원이 추가되었습니다. 이는 커널의 프리엠프션 논리와 설정 옵션을 단순화하여 더 나은 결과를 제공하기 위한 노력입니다. 이 기능은 향후 스케줄러 관련 호출을 줄이는 데 도움이 될 것입니다.
프로세스 정보 가져오기
리눅스 6.13에서는 새로운 PIDFD_GET_INFO ioctl() 연산을 통해 pidfd로 표시된 프로세스에 대한 정보를 가져오는 기능이 추가되었습니다. 이로 인해 성능이 향상된 커널 빌드를 생성하는 데도 기여할 것입니다.
파일 시스템의 변화
리눅스 6.11에서는 NVMe와 SCSI의 블록 장치에 대한 원자적 쓰기 지원이 추가되었고, 6.13에서는 ext4 및 XFS 파일 시스템으로 이 지원이 확장되었습니다. 이는 전원 고장 또는 하드웨어 고장 시 모든 또는 아무 데이터도 손실되지 않도록 보호하는 기능입니다.
하드웨어 드라이버 개선
이번 업데이트로 인해 Raspberry Pi에서 사용되는 Broadcom V3D 커널 드라이버가 개선되었으며, 새로운 장치와 주변기기에 대한 많은 신규 드라이버가 추가되었습니다. 예를 들어, $80짜리 Corsair Void 헤드셋과 Apple의 Magic Trackpad 2의 USB-C 버전에 대한 지원이 포함됩니다.
리눅스 커널 6.13 설치 안내
우분투에서 리눅스 6.13 커널을 설치하고 싶으신가요? 코드 컴파일에 익숙하다면 직접 소스 코드를 다운로드하여 설치할 수 있습니다. (소스 코드 여기에서 확인하실 수 있습니다.) 그렇지 않은 경우, 누군가가 패키지 업데이트를 제공할 때까지 기다려야 합니다.
우분투 LTS 사용자들은 최신 우분투 릴리스에서 가져온 주요 커널 업데이트를 받을 수 있으나, 이번 리눅스 커널 6.13는 우분투 25.04 출시전에는 HWE의 일부로 포함되지 않을 것으로 보입니다.
결론
리눅스 커널 6.13의 출시로 인해 많은 기능이 새롭게 추가되었고, 각종 하드웨어의 호환성을 높이며 성능을 개선하는 데 기여했습니다. 리눅스는 여전히 유연하고 적응력이 뛰어나며, 개발자들이 기술적 장점을 위해 끊임없이 개선하고 있다는 점이 인상적입니다.
지금까지 리눅스 커널 6.13에 대한 소식을 전해드렸습니다. 더 많은 정보가 궁금하시다면 LWN의 커널 리포트를 참고하시기 바랍니다. 자, 모두들 멋진 리눅스 경험을 즐기세요!